"Brown Bag Retreat Time!"

I'll be able to finish some projects for sure this month since I'll be attending a "Brown Bag" Quilt Retreat in Buellton, CA, hosted by The Creation Station Quilt Shop. I've been attending at least two Brown Bag Retreats per year for several years now. It's three days of all the quilting you choose to do and the best fun!!

One of my closest friends, Nancy, works and attends these retreats, so I join her, often spending the weekend with her. Other times Nick and I take the RV and stay at the Flying Flags RV Resort with our friends, Lynn and Rick from Redding. The guys hang out at the campground, go fishing, play horseshoes, etc, while Lynn and I meet Nancy and quilt away the hours for 3 days! For this retreat we're taking the RV, meeting Lynn and Rick at Flying Flags, so it's going to be a great weekend for sure!!


As any quilter knows when attending a quilt retreat it's best to take several projects to do, because you never know how much you'll get done or what you'll feel like working on. You wouldn't want to run out of options, should you find yourself stuck on a pattern, or just in the mood to work on another project, so it's good to have choices and a variety of projects just in case!

PS Another quilt reveal: here's the front of the "4 Squares and Animals" Baby Boy Quilt I finished in July for my friend's daughter, due in a week or so.....
I was able to find fabrics that matched the colors of the baby's room. I appliqued baby animals in the solid squares and surrounded them with 4 squares and a pieced border. I made a personalized label too!
